Why These Are the Top Walk-in Tubs Contractors in Leggett

** The walk-in tub market for Leggett, Texas, is characterized by a reliance on regional service providers from larger hubs like Lufkin, Livingston, and Tyler. There are no dedicated walk-in tub companies physically located within Leggett city limits. The competition level is moderate, with a handful of highly-specialized providers and several general contractors capable of performing installations. Service quality among the top-tier providers is generally high, as they rely on reputation and word-of-mouth in a close-knit regional community. Typical pricing for a complete walk-in tub solution (tub unit plus professional installation) in this region generally starts at **$5,000** for a basic model and can exceed **$15,000** for high-end units with advanced hydrotherapy jets and custom tile work or bathroom modifications. Most reputable companies offer free in-home estimates and financing options, which is a critical service for the senior demographic that predominantly seeks these products. The top providers distinguish themselves through specialized knowledge, manufacturer certifications, and robust warranty programs on both labor and the tub unit itself.

1What is the typical cost range for a walk-in tub installation in Leggett, Texas, and what factors influence the final price?

In the Leggett area, a complete walk-in tub installation typically ranges from $5,000 to $15,000+. The final cost is influenced by the tub model (basic vs. therapeutic with jets), the complexity of your existing bathroom plumbing and electrical setup, and any necessary structural modifications to your home. Regional factors like material transportation costs to our more rural location can also slightly impact pricing compared to larger Texas metro areas.

2How long does a full walk-in tub installation take for a homeowner in Leggett, and are there seasonal considerations for scheduling?

A professional installation usually takes 1 to 3 days, depending on the project's complexity. For Leggett homeowners, scheduling is best planned outside of peak summer humidity and heat, which can make the indoor work less comfortable, and considering our East Texas rainy season in spring and fall that could delay any necessary material deliveries. Planning ahead is key, especially during busy periods.

3Are there any specific permits or local regulations in Leggett or Polk County I need to be aware of for installing a walk-in tub?

Yes, while Texas has no statewide plumbing license, Polk County and the City of Leggett may require a permit for the plumbing and electrical work involved. A reputable local installer will handle securing all necessary permits, ensuring the installation complies with Texas building codes and local ordinances, which is crucial for your safety and home's resale value.

5I'm concerned about the higher water usage of filling a deep tub. Is this a significant issue with our local water in Leggett?

This is a common and valid concern. Modern walk-in tubs are designed for efficiency, and many models feature fill-and-drain systems that use less water than you might expect. Given that Leggett residents often rely on well water or municipal systems, discussing water-saving features like quick-fill faucets and low-flow options with your installer is important to manage both your water usage and utility costs effectively.
